ANOTHER ELECTRIC CAR FROM RENAULT

Despite the fact that the event will be held in the shadow of coronavirus, there will be no shortage of world premieres. One of them is a new electric version of a small Renault-the Twingo Z. E. model.

At first glance, the car is no different from its internal combustion. The distinctive feature of the electrified class is an exceptionally Thin blue sticker that stretches across the entire side of the car (from the front to the rear lights). An alternative drive is also given out by blue inserts on the radiator cap and a badge with the inscription Z. E. Electric on the glass rear door. As in the internal combustion version, the drive is transferred to the wheels of the rear axle. The electric traction engine generates 82 HP and 160 Nm.

Energy is stored in 165 kg of lithium-ion batteries. the Power of 22 kWh allows you to cover a distance of up to 250 km, measured in the WLTP City cycle (up to 180 km in the mixed cycle). The Renault Twingo EV accelerates to 100 km/h in 13.5 seconds and reaches a top speed of 135 km/h.Sprint to 50 km / h in 4.5 seconds. It takes 13.5 hours to fully charge the batteries from a household outlet (230 Volts, 2.3 kW * h). using a 3.7 kW mains charger, the time can be reduced to approximately 8 hours.
